From the MOD to being a Gas Engineer
Name
Gary Speirs
Course
Multi Skilled Gas Engineer with Electric (Level 2 and 3)
Gary Speirs had initially considered a career in Plumbing when he joined Civvy Street after 24 years in HM Forces. Gary 40 of Barrow-in-Furness is currently studying for his City & Guilds 6132 Gas Engineering with Part P.
‘I always fancied being a plumber but when I started researching courses about two years ago being a Gas Engineer sounded better.’
Gary was introduced to MET by Kevin Glasgow, his employer, who is also an ex service man.
‘I came to the Rotherham site for a visit, and was so impressed by the academy’s facilities that I signed up the same day. Everyone was really friendly and helpful. Tim our instructor is extremely patient and understanding. He’s always there for you if he thinks you’re stuck with anything. He’s an excellent instructor.’
So why did Gary decide to re-train for a trade?
‘I wanted the challenge of working on my own and not as part of team as I used to. To know that you are personally responsible for a job well done is extremely satisfying and I love that no two jobs are the same. Gaining a new qualification is also something to be proud of and to be able to help someone by safely fixing things around the home is enough job satisfaction for me.’
